EHL Hockey League Week 12 2023 Matchday Review

As the winter break comes to a close, the Vitality Women's Hockey League and Men's Hockey League Premier division is back in full swing. Jade Bloomfield of Hockey World News looks at the first weekend of Phase Two as the Premier division splits into two mini-leagues, the "Top Six" and the "Lower Six", with each group having its own distinct goals and challenges.

In the Top Six, the automatic European spot race began, with teams battling it out to secure their place in the top tier of European club hockey. The competition is expected to be intense, with some of the best teams in the country fighting for the coveted spot.

Meanwhile, the teams are fighting for survival in the Lower Six and the remaining two playoff places. With just a few points separating the teams, every match is crucial, and the competition is expected to be just as intense as in the top Six.
